We are asking that you reveiw the new proposed standards issued by the United States Postal Service. Once you review them please outline how this will impact your organization. Please include your company name in your comments. We plan to submit all comments by January 26th, 2009. Please help us to convince the USPS that these changes will impact most of their clients in a negative manner by ultimately forcing higher prices for production.
The highlights are:
* A requirement in many cases of 3 tabs to a self-mailer
* No longer allowing tabs on the top (open) side of the mail piece, instead they must be placed on each side
* Increasing the size of the tab to 1.5" and recommending 2" tabs be used
* Not allowing perforation in tabs
* Reducing the size of the mail piece to 6" x 10.5 (instead of 6.125 x 11.5) to maintain letter size rates * Reducing the weight to 3 oz
